One-Dimensional Quasi-Exactly Solvable Schr\"odinger Equations [PDF]

open access: yes, 2016
Quasi-Exactly Solvable Schrodinger Equations occupy an intermediate place between exactly-solvable (e.g. the harmonic oscillator and Coulomb problems etc) and non-solvable ones. Mainly, they were discovered in the 1980ies.

New solvable and quasiexactly solvable periodic potentials [PDF]

open access: yesJournal of Mathematical Physics, 1999
Using the formalism of supersymmetric quantum mechanics, we obtain a large number of new analytically solvable one-dimensional periodic potentials and study their properties. More specifically, the supersymmetric partners of the Lamé potentials ma(a+1)sn2(x,m) are computed for integer values a=1,2,3,… .

Schrödinger potentials solvable in terms of the general Heun functions [PDF]

open access: yes, 2016
We show that there exist 35 choices for the coordinate transformation each leading to a potential for which the stationary Schrodinger equation is exactly solvable in terms of the general Heun functions.
